About The Position

Are you a strategic thinker with a builder’s mindset? At 3E, we’re transforming the future of compliance and sustainability with powerful, data-driven solutions — and reimagining how organizations can work smarter, faster, and more sustainably. As a Senior Product Go-To-Market (GTM) Manager, you won’t just support product launches — you’ll shape how they succeed in market. This senior-level role is an opportunity to define and scale go-to-market strategies that accelerate growth, drive customer value, and strengthen our leadership in the environmental health and safety (EHS) tech space. It’s also a chance to be part of building disruptive, next-generation products that embed intelligence into customer workflows and create meaningful impact in a space hungry for innovation. This role is ideal for someone who enjoys establishing scalable processes, knows how to translate vision into executable programs, and enjoys partnering cross-functionally to make big things happen. Day-to-day activities will focus on strategic planning and execution program management, including leading the launch process for the launch of new capabilities, maintaining our overall solution positioning, and helping design and enable GTM motions to accelerate growth. Additionally, you will drive long-term customer value by monitoring and supporting the adoption of new features and driving product use. You’ll be at the center of collaboration between Product, Marketing, Sales, Rev Ops, Commercial Enablement, and Customer teams.

Requirements

  • Experience: 4+ years of experience in product management, product strategy, or product marketing with accountability for GTM strategy and orchestration— ideally in B2B SaaS, information services, or regulatory/sustainability tech. Experience or interest in EHS, compliance, or sustainability domains is highly valued.
  • Broad GTM Expertise: Should have a strong working knowledge of Product Management Principles, Strategic Marketing Principles, and the B2B Sales Process. A proven track record of developing and executing high-impact GTM strategies that led to product adoption, market expansion, or revenue growth.
  • Communication: Excellent written and verbal communication skills to effectively communicate with various stakeholders.
  • Analytical Skills: String market sensing skills. Ability to analyze data, identify trends, and make data-driven decisions.
  • Leadership/Influence: Exceptional collaborator with the ability to lead and motivate cross-functional teams. Must be skilled at aligning stakeholders around a shared vision while driving accountability.
  • Project Management: Strong project management skills to manage complex projects and drive execution across teams.

Responsibilities

  • Strategic Planning: Developing and executing GTM strategies, including market analysis, product positioning, and launch planning.
  • Program Management/Driving Cross-functional Collaboration: Working with marketing, sales, engineering, and other teams to ensure a unified approach to product launches and driving value across the entire customer experience.
  • Market Sensing/Insights and ICP Alignment: Understanding customer needs, competitive landscapes, and market trends to inform product and GTM strategies. Leading marketing research and competitive intelligence gathering workstreams.
  • Leading and Driving the Product Launch Process Leveraging our launch framework, lead and coordinate cross-functional go-to-market efforts for product launches, including positioning, messaging, enablement, and execution planning. Partner closely with Product, Marketing, Sales, and Customer Success to ensure alignment, readiness, and a seamless rollout that drives adoption and revenue impact.
  • Product Positioning and Messaging: Defining the unique value proposition of the product and crafting compelling, differentiated messaging for key buyer personas.
  • Sales/GTM Motion Enablement: Providing sales, account management, and customer teams with the necessary training, resources, and support to effectively sell the product and retain and grow accounts. Lead development of GTM aids ranging from pricing guidance, assets, bundling strategies, and enablement tools that empower Sales, Marketing, and Customer teams.
  • Performance Monitoring: Tracking key performance indicators (KPIs) related to win rate, product usage and adoption, customer satisfaction, and revenue generation. Identify outages and drive optimization
  • Adaptability: Adjusting the GTM strategy and supporting customer-centric innovation based on market feedback and performance data.
